The Asner End Table from Surya pursues minimalist vocabulary through arched openings carved into solid mango wood that form a cubic volume. Oval voids pierce each side panel, creating visual passageways that lighten the cube's mass without compromising structural integrity. The openings introduce negative space as an active design element rather than simply removing material for decoration. Indian craftspeople shape each table by cutting and finishing wood to reveal grain patterns across both flat surfaces and curved voids.
